在当今数字化的时代,网页格式的转换是我们常常会遇到的问题之一,MHTML 向 HTML 的转换就是一个较为常见但又可能让人感到困惑的操作。
MHTML(MIME HTML),是一种将网页的所有元素(包括文本、图像、样式表等)打包在一个单一文件中的格式,而 HTML(HyperText Markup Language)则是我们更为熟悉的网页标记语言,通常由多个相互关联的文件组成,如 HTML 文本文件、CSS 样式表文件和图像文件等。
为什么我们会想要将 MHTML 转换为 HTML 呢?这可能有多种原因,某些特定的应用程序或工具可能只支持 HTML 格式,或者在进行网页开发和编辑时,HTML 的灵活性和可操作性更强。
要实现 MHTML 到 HTML 的转换,我们有几种可行的方法,一种常见的方法是使用专门的转换工具,在网上,您可以找到许多免费或付费的 MHTML 到 HTML 转换工具,这些工具通常操作简单,只需将 MHTML 文件导入,然后点击转换按钮,即可得到相应的 HTML 文件。
另一种方法是通过编程来实现转换,对于有一定编程基础的朋友来说,可以使用 Python 等编程语言来处理 MHTML 文件,并将其解析和转换为 HTML 格式,这需要对相关的库和算法有一定的了解,但可以实现更定制化的转换过程。
如果您对网页技术有较深入的了解,还可以手动拆解 MHTML 文件,提取其中的 HTML 部分和相关资源,并重新组合成 HTML 格式,不过,这种方法相对较为复杂,需要对网页的结构和编码有清晰的认识。
需要注意的是,在进行 MHTML 到 HTML 的转换过程中,可能会遇到一些问题,某些特殊的编码格式可能导致转换后的内容出现乱码,或者某些复杂的网页结构可能无法完美转换,通过合适的方法和工具,我们能够在大多数情况下成功完成转换。
接下来回答关于《MHTML 如何变成 HTML》的问题:
问题一:转换后的 HTML 文件与原 MHTML 文件在显示效果上会完全一致吗?
答案:一般情况下,转换后的 HTML 文件能够大致保持与原 MHTML 文件相同的显示效果,但在某些复杂的网页中,可能会存在一些细微的差异,例如某些特殊的样式或布局可能无法完全一致。
问题二:转换过程中如果出现乱码怎么办?
答案:如果出现乱码,首先检查源文件的编码格式是否正确识别,可以尝试使用不同的转换工具或设置正确的编码参数来解决乱码问题。
问题三:有没有在线免费的 MHTML 转 HTML 工具推荐?
答案:您可以尝试使用“Convertio”、“Zamzar”等在线转换工具,它们通常提供免费的 MHTML 到 HTML 转换服务,但可能会对文件大小或转换次数有一定限制。
相关文章
- 探索 HTML 中 Ajax 请求的神秘世界与实战应用,探索 HTML 中 Ajax 请求,神秘世界与实战应用
- 深度解析,HTML 中 Span 元素位置设置的多种方法,HTML 中 Span 元素位置设置的深度解析
- 深入解析 HTML 中的 CloneNode方法及其应用,HTML 中 CloneNode 方法的深度解析与应用
- 深入探索,HTML 中 jQuery 的巧妙运用之道,深入探索 HTML 中 jQuery 的运用之道
- 深入探究,HTML 制作 CHM 文件的详细步骤与技巧,HTML 制作 CHM 文件,深入探究步骤与技巧
- 深入探索,HTML 中实现垂直文字居中的 CSS 技巧,HTML 中垂直文字居中的 CSS 技巧探索
评论已关闭